Address 2.41946793 DOGE

D6XkTZyiyPXYPcV99zJ4P8KuWTxDfBm6Rx

Confirmed

Total Received2.41946793 DOGE
Total Sent0 DOGE
Final Balance2.41946793 DOGE
No. Transactions1

Transactions